Tranmere Rovers are delighted to announce the signing of left-back Connor Wood on a contract until the end of the season.
The 27-year-old joins the Club after leaving League Two champions Leyton Orient in the summer. He spent the second half of last season on loan at Colchester United, where he made 16 appearances for the U’s.
Having started his career in non-league, he played for Leicester City’s development squad for two years before signing a three-year contract with Bradford City in 2018.
Wood made 115 appearances for the Bantams, scoring three goals and making 10 assists. He joined Orient at the end of his contract at Valley Parade and played 38 times for the London club.
Manager Ian Dawes said: “We are very pleased to welcome Connor into the group. He’s a top professional with lots of experience at this level.
“He fits the description of a Tranmere player. He’s hard working, an excellent defender and has good crossing ability. He is a good pro with a great character and will fit in well with the squad.”
